In this episode of Spiritual Appointment, the preacher teaches that most suffering in life is imposed on us, not willingly chosen. While people naturally try to avoid pain and hardship, he explains that avoiding trouble often leads to greater problems. As Christians, suffering and trials are part of our journey of faith. God uses difficult seasons to strengthen us, build our character, and deepen our trust in Him. Instead of running from challenges, we should embrace them and remain faithful. The message ends with hope and encouragement: after every trouble comes growth, breakthrough, and promotion from God.

Spiritual Appointment reminds us of Jesus’ predestined suffering. As Christians, we must embrace trials instead of avoiding them, because every trouble brings growth, and after every season of pain comes promotion.
